Display case and cabinet glass for fixture manufacturers

Glass for retail cases, museum vitrines and store fixtures — low-iron for clarity, polished edges for exposed joints, and low-distortion tempering so the reflection doesn't ripple.

SPECIFICATIONS

Display case glass — specs at a glance

Max panel size 90" × 144"
Thickness 5/32"–1/2" (4–12 mm)
Glass types Low-iron preferred; clear and tinted available
Edgework Flat polish, pencil edge, miter
Fabrication Holes, notches, countersinks — all before tempering
Size tolerance ± 1/32" on cut size; squareness within 1/16"
Standards CPSC 16 CFR 1201, ANSI Z97.1, ASTM C1048 · permanent temper mark
Lead time 7–12 business days on polished work

FAQ

Questions we get about display case glass

Something not covered? Call the shop — you'll reach someone who has run the oven.

Why low-iron for display work?

Standard clear glass carries a green cast on exposed edges and washes out product color at thickness. Low-iron reads neutral, which matters in a case with lighting.

Can you drill for patch fittings and pulls?

Yes — all holes, notches and countersinks are cut before tempering, so send the hardware template with the drawing.

How flat is your tempered glass?

We can run low-distortion cycles for display work where roller wave would show in a lit reflection. Flag it on the order.
